Apollo Management Holdings L.P. purchased a new position in shares of CommScope Holding Company, Inc. (NASDAQ:COMM - Free Report) during the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or purchased 6,178,079 shares of the communications equipment provider's stock, valued at approximately $32,806,000. CommScope makes up approximately 0.6% of Apollo Management Holdings L.P.'s investment portfolio, making the stock its 14th biggest position. Apollo Management Holdings L.P. owned about 2.85% of CommScope as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

CommScope (NASDAQ:COMM -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Monday, August 4th. The communications equipment provider reported $0.44 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.24 by $0.20. The company had revenue of $1.39 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.27 billion. CommScope had a net margin of 16.61% and a negative return on equity of 6.29%. CommScope's revenue for the quarter was up 31.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$0.34 earnings per share. About CommScope

(Free Report)

CommScope Holding Company, Inc provides infrastructure solutions for communications, data center, and entertainment networks worldwide. The company operates through Connectivity and Cable Solutions (CCS); Outdoor Wireless Networks (OWN); Networking, Intelligent Cellular and Security Solutions (NICS), and Access Network Solutions (ANS) segments.
